/*! |
|
\brief The Thermometer Widget |
|
|
|
QwtThermo is a widget which displays a value in an interval. It supports: |
|
- a horizontal or vertical layout; |
|
- a range; |
|
- a scale; |
|
- an alarm level. |
|
|
|
\image html sysinfo.png |
|
|
|
By default, the scale and range run over the same interval of values. |
|
QwtAbstractScale::setScale() changes the interval of the scale and allows |
|
easy conversion between physical units. |
|
|
|
The example shows how to make the scale indicate in degrees Fahrenheit and |
|
to set the value in degrees Kelvin: |
|
\code |
|
#include <qapplication.h> |
|
#include <qwt_thermo.h> |
|
|
|
double Kelvin2Fahrenheit(double kelvin) |
|
{ |
|
// see http://en.wikipedia.org/wiki/Kelvin |
|
return 1.8*kelvin - 459.67; |
|
} |
|
|
|
int main(int argc, char **argv) |
|
{ |
|
const double minKelvin = 0.0; |
|
const double maxKelvin = 500.0; |
|
|
|
QApplication a(argc, argv); |
|
QwtThermo t; |
|
t.setRange(minKelvin, maxKelvin); |
|
t.setScale(Kelvin2Fahrenheit(minKelvin), Kelvin2Fahrenheit(maxKelvin)); |
|
// set the value in Kelvin but the scale displays in Fahrenheit |
|
// 273.15 Kelvin = 0 Celsius = 32 Fahrenheit |
|
t.setValue(273.15); |
|
a.setMainWidget(&t); |
|
t.show(); |
|
return a.exec(); |
|
} |
|
\endcode |
|
|
|
\todo Improve the support for a logarithmic range and/or scale. |
|
*/ |
